Greater value of standard reduction potential, smaller will be tendency

Correct answer: A. to form positive ions

  • A. to form positive ions
  • B. to form negative tons
  • C. gain electrons
  • D. all are possible

Explanation

A higher standard reduction potential indicates a greater tendency for a species to gain electrons and be reduced. Conversely, it signifies a lower tendency to lose electrons and form positive ions.

About Electrochemistry

Electrochemistry describes electron transfer through oxidation and reduction, identifies oxidizing and reducing agents, and applies oxidation numbers to balance redox equations. It also covers electrode potential and the standard hydrogen electrode, which provides the reference for comparing the reduction tendencies of other electrodes.
